The late Nigel Graham wrote the original description and when I embodied it in my own build I did some minor editing and added photos to turn it into a document acceptable to LAA Engineering. Im pleased to know that it is still of use. I was in correspondence with LAA Engineering earlier this year after noticing some out-of-date stuff on the original document. My suggestion to amend it and submit a new version was accepted, but so far the new PDF I sent in has not made its way to the LAA website. I am happy to send the April 2022 Issue 2 PDF to anyone who would like to have it. Just confirm it is not leaking from the fuel vent outlet and fuel intake to t he tank? Then dripping down to the floor on the starboard side. Have had a b uilder here who didn=99t allow enough room for the intake boss to move and cracked the intake boss.
